    I wouldn't exactly say 34028 was resident when it came in 2006. That may have been the plan but it was failed after about two weeks with 833 miles on the clock (with slipped tyres from memory) and returned.
    A Merchant Navy has never visited the Moors.
    As for 34101, it'll be ready when its ready but don't hold your breath.

    34028 was active for a bit longer than two weeks in 2006, Steve. I have a photo of it on shed at Grosmont on 19/4/06. It is facing north so presumably was recently arrived at that time. I have pictures of it working on a couple of occasions during May and had my only firing turn (one trip) on it on the 7/6/06. My last picture of it was on 17/6/06 shortly before it was withdrawn. As I recall it was stopped with slipped tyres as you say, caused in part by a repeatedly sticking steam brake. 06-6-7 5 34028 Levisham copy.jpg

    Here it is on the occasion of my one firing turn on it.

    No. 4953 Pitchford Hall is replacing the previously announced guest locomotive, No. 4079 Pendennis Castle, which had to withdraw from the event due to issues with possible boiler water carry over into its cylinders. Courtesy of the Epping Ongar Railway.
